find /mnt/foo/* -maxdepth 0 -print -exec rsync -an `realpath {}`
/mnt/bar/ \;
(realpath eliminates the trailing slashes)
On 8/3/23 22:27, Fourhundred Thecat via rsync wrote:
Hello,
I am copying /mnt/foo to /mnt/bar/
rsync --info=name1,del2 -rl /mnt/foo /mnt/bar/
/mnt/foo contains deep di
> On 2023-08-04 06:13, Perry Hutchison wrote:
Perry Hutchison via rsync wrote:
On second thought, that grep will match any directory name having 3
*or more* levels. This:
rsync --info=name1,del2 -rl /mnt/foo /mnt/bar/ | egrep
'^/[^/]*/[^/]*/[^/]*/$'
should match only those with exactly 3
Perry Hutchison via rsync wrote:
> Fourhundred Thecat via rsync <400the...@lists.samba.org> wrote:
>
> > I am copying /mnt/foo to /mnt/bar/
> >
> >rsync --info=name1,del2 -rl /mnt/foo /mnt/bar/
> >
> > /mnt/foo contains deep directory structure, ie:
> >
> >/mnt/foo/aaa/
> >/mnt/foo/aa
Fourhundred Thecat via rsync <400the...@lists.samba.org> wrote:
> I am copying /mnt/foo to /mnt/bar/
>
>rsync --info=name1,del2 -rl /mnt/foo /mnt/bar/
>
> /mnt/foo contains deep directory structure, ie:
>
>/mnt/foo/aaa/
>/mnt/foo/aaa/somestuff/
>/mnt/foo/aaa/somestuff/file1
>
>
Hello,
I am copying /mnt/foo to /mnt/bar/
rsync --info=name1,del2 -rl /mnt/foo /mnt/bar/
/mnt/foo contains deep directory structure, ie:
/mnt/foo/aaa/
/mnt/foo/aaa/somestuff/
/mnt/foo/aaa/somestuff/file1
/mnt/foo/bbb/
/mnt/foo/bbb/someotherstuff/
/mnt/foo/bbb/someotherstuff/file